JH Haroun is a font designed for impact. Its primary applications are for short-form, high-visibility content where its calligraphic beauty can truly shine. It is identified as ideal for titles, book covers, greeting cards, and headlines, rather than large bodies of body text. The font's design is optimized for display use, ensuring that its intricate details and dramatic forms are legible and visually striking even at larger sizes.

The font is available for commercial licensing, meaning it is not free for most professional uses unless a license is purchased. This is typical for high-quality, specialized typefaces that represent a significant investment in design and programming. A wide range of licensing options is typically available, including licenses for desktop use, web use, and mobile apps, allowing designers to integrate JH Haroun into various types of projects. jh haroun font

As explained by its creators, JH Haroun is "based on the calligraphic Thuluth script". However, its most remarkable features lie in its technical execution. The font contains over two thousand glyphs. This massive character set goes far beyond the standard letters of the Arabic alphabet, including a vast array of contextual alternates and ligatures that allow the font to accurately reproduce the complex and nuanced connections between letters that are the hallmark of skilled calligraphy.
